Output fe51496966082272ada07c1da60bdf219bbd7439a41ff2b235b5ddf8c6dab893:1

value
10943150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a43b40b83d1dff7235272b18a3e4d84d85c312fa OP_EQUAL
address
3GfPixiYwJxCiQDGmJG9mMK3MHMaBaFKyM
transaction
fe51496966082272ada07c1da60bdf219bbd7439a41ff2b235b5ddf8c6dab893
confirmations
272960
spent
true